--- Comment #10 from Christoph Feck <cf...@kde.org> --- > understand what kind of input system KDE is using To answer this question: KDE applications or Plasma doesn't have an input system. All input is handled in Qt, except for special input widgets such as Kate/KWrite. Qt itself gets input from either X11 or libinput, depending on what session type you use. The task Nate referenced doesn't propose any "native" KDE method either, because then it would only work with KDE applications. You really need a low-level (X)IM tool. -- You are receiving this mail because: You are watching all bug changes.
